The Role of AI in Creative Spaces

AI is dramatically transforming how we approach creation in various fields, including design. While it can expedite some processes, it also challenges notions of creativity and artistry.

1. Benefits of AI in Art and Design

AI tools can streamline workflows, generate ideas, and assist in the repetitive aspects of design. Creatives can leverage AI for tasks like color selection and layout design, enhancing efficiency without compromising artistic vision. However, they must be cautious about relying too heavily on technology, as it could lead to a cookie-cutter approach that lacks distinctiveness.

2. Challenges of AI Utilization

Despite the benefits, reliance on AI also poses risks—especially when combined with questionable practices. The risk of plagiarism rises significantly if designs are generated using uncredited sources. Thus, protecting your brand reputation becomes paramount.

Setting Practical Boundaries in Logo Design

Logo design is a critical facet of branding, and establishing boundaries during this process can ensure the output aligns with brand values.

1. Define Design Parameters

When beginning a logo design, defining specific parameters or guidelines is essential. This can include color palettes, typography styles, or the overarching theme of the logo. By setting these boundaries, designers can maintain a consistent brand image across various platforms. For detailed tutorials on logo design, explore our resources on logo design processes.

2. Decide on AI’s Role

AI can serve as a tool within logo design, but its role must be carefully considered. Determine the extent to which AI will generate designs versus human creativity—those who draw boundaries around AI’s involvement can ensure that the final product remains unique and representative of the brand's vision.

3. Evaluate Output for Originality

Consistency is critical, but so is creativity. Evaluating logo outputs for originality means scrutinizing AI-generated designs alongside traditional approaches. For example, if an AI outputs several variations of a logo, designers should analyze them against community standards to detect any potential copyright issues.
